This engraving from the end of the 19th century depicts Gustave II Adolphe, also known as the Great or the Northern Lion, disembarking in Pomerania on July 6,1630. The print showcases a pivotal moment in history when this renowned king arrived on German soil during a time of war. The image portrays Gustave II Adolphe's arrival with great detail and precision. Clad in his majestic armor, he stands tall at the forefront of a boat that has just reached the coastline. Surrounding him are multiple people engaged in prayer, their faces filled with hope and determination. As one gazes upon this artwork, it becomes evident that it captures not only a military landing but also an atmosphere charged with anticipation and bravery. The Swedish flag proudly flutters above them, symbolizing their allegiance to their homeland. Gustave II Adolphe was revered for his strategic brilliance and leadership abilities.
